Output 4c042fc65ec2404ff541ef0e90475bb594cebcd731d2efd600b3fa6eb3b4ff1a:0

value
27582776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 880c2b3dbec620e740c30d28d0273e5f5bb2360c OP_EQUALVERIFY OP_CHECKSIG
address
1DQMUbnMf55JHqgLTdpLX9aYPGCnhuRie1
transaction
4c042fc65ec2404ff541ef0e90475bb594cebcd731d2efd600b3fa6eb3b4ff1a
spent
true